ABSTRACT

Background:

Infants with complex heart disease often have delayed development, learning difficulties and mental health problems as they grow older. Their parents and other caregivers engage in online health information (OHIS) behavior to understand and support their child's health and development.

Objective:

This study describes the presence, nature, and presentation of information about neurodevelopment on the websites of congenital heart programs in the United States.

Methods:

This study used a mixed methods approach, specifically a convergent design. The presence and presentation of information about neurodevelopment on each program's website was correlated with state-level and program-specific factors extracted from multiple publicly available databases. Quantitative analysis methods included descriptive analyses, Student t-tests, Pearson chi-square tests, and multivariate logistic regression analysis, all performed using SPSS. Qualitative methods included both inductive and deductive content analysis.

Results:

Only 39% (50/129) programs provided any information about neurodevelopment online. High surgical volume correlated with the presence of online information (p<0.001). Websites were written at an average 7th to 10th grade reading level and fewer than 5% of websites had information in a language other than English. Two semantic clusters of website format, content, and element selection were identified, reflecting distinct approaches to adult learners. Programs clustered into "sage on the stage" and "guide on the side" formats. Few websites incorporated features caregivers have identified as useful with only 6% including all features.

Conclusions:

This study highlights the paucity of accessible caregiver-oriented information about neurodevelopment on the program websites of congenital heart programs in the United States. This lack may negatively impact caregiver understanding of and engagement with neurodevelopmental services for their child with a critical congenital heart defect. Clinical Trial: none
